加入收藏 | 设为首页 | 会员中心 | 我要投稿 开发网_商丘站长网 (https://www.0370zz.com/)- AI硬件、CDN、大数据、云上网络、数据采集!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

无代码站长揭秘:ASP嵌入式驱动网站开发

发布时间:2026-03-21 13:22:55 所属栏目:Asp教程 来源:DaWei
导读:  在传统网站开发领域,ASP(Active Server Pages)技术曾是服务器端脚本的代表之一。它通过嵌入HTML页面中的脚本代码实现动态功能,需要开发者掌握VBScript或JScript语法,并具备数据库交互、服务器配置等专业知识

  在传统网站开发领域,ASP(Active Server Pages)技术曾是服务器端脚本的代表之一。它通过嵌入HTML页面中的脚本代码实现动态功能,需要开发者掌握VBScript或JScript语法,并具备数据库交互、服务器配置等专业知识。然而,随着低代码/无代码工具的普及,许多站长开始探索如何将ASP的强大功能与可视化开发模式结合,实现更高效的网站搭建。这种趋势背后,是开发者对“降低技术门槛”与“保持开发灵活性”双重需求的平衡。


AI绘图,仅供参考

  ASP的核心优势在于其与Windows服务器的深度集成。通过IIS(Internet Information Services)的内置支持,ASP页面可直接调用COM组件、访问Access或SQL Server数据库,无需额外配置中间件。例如,一个简单的用户登录功能,只需在HTML表单中嵌入语句输出验证结果,或在后台用ADO对象连接数据库查询凭证。这种“所见即所得”的调试方式,曾让ASP成为快速原型开发的利器。但传统开发模式要求开发者手动编写所有代码,包括页面布局、数据绑定和异常处理,对新手极不友好。


  无代码工具的出现,为ASP开发带来了新的可能。现代无代码平台通过可视化界面生成前端页面,并自动生成对应的ASP后端逻辑。例如,用户拖拽一个“登录表单”组件到画布上,平台会同时生成HTML表单代码、ASP验证脚本以及数据库查询语句。更高级的平台甚至支持自定义ASP函数库,允许开发者将常用功能(如分页查询、权限校验)封装为可复用的模块,通过简单的配置调用。这种模式下,开发者无需记忆语法细节,只需关注业务逻辑的实现路径。


  以用户管理系统开发为例,传统ASP需要手动创建用户表、编写注册/登录页面、设计会话管理机制,整个过程可能涉及数百行代码。而在无代码环境中,开发者只需定义用户表结构(字段名、数据类型),平台会自动生成CRUD(增删改查)接口和对应的ASP处理页面。若需扩展功能,如发送注册验证码,只需在平台的事件触发器中绑定“发送邮件”动作,并配置SMTP服务器参数即可。这种开发方式将技术细节封装在平台内部,使开发者能更专注于用户体验设计。


  尽管无代码工具简化了开发流程,但ASP的嵌入式特性仍需注意技术兼容性。例如,某些平台生成的ASP代码可能依赖特定版本的IIS或.NET Framework,迁移到其他服务器时需调整配置。复杂业务逻辑(如多表关联查询、事务处理)仍可能需要手动编写ASP脚本补充。对此,成熟的平台会提供“代码注入”功能,允许开发者在可视化流程中插入自定义ASP代码片段,实现灵活扩展。这种“无代码+低代码”的混合模式,既保留了开发效率,又避免了完全依赖平台导致的锁定风险。


  对于站长而言,选择ASP嵌入式无代码开发需权衡利弊。若项目需求简单(如企业官网、博客),且团队缺乏专业ASP开发者,无代码平台能显著缩短开发周期;若涉及高并发、复杂业务逻辑或定制化功能,仍需结合传统ASP开发或选择更强大的框架(如ASP.NET Core)。无论如何,技术工具的进化始终围绕“提升效率”展开。未来,随着AI辅助编码技术的成熟,ASP开发或许会彻底摆脱代码编写,通过自然语言描述直接生成可运行的网站系统。

(编辑:开发网_商丘站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章